Platinized anodes are manufactured with a titanium or niobium base structure, in the form of either expanded metal, sheet, rod, wire or tube. A thin plating of platinum between 2 to 5 microns thick is maintained on these various shaped anodes made-ready for electro plating at plating baths. These platinum plated anodes possess the electro chemical properties of platinum and behaves like pure platinum metal. Platinized plating anodes coating/ layer thickness ranges from minimum 1.5 micron to max 20 micron.

Tiaano Platinised Titanium Anode for Hard Chrome Plating. Current hard chromium plating processes are principally based on chromic acid and sulfuric acid. The nature of chrome electroplating bath can impact the longevity of the anodes. In particular, free fluoride ions; it can attack the metals of the anode and cause corrosion. 

Lead tin alloy anodes are commonly used for hard chrome plating. But the sludge of lead chromate is usually formed on the bottom of the plating tank. As a soft metal, lead alloy anode is easily deform or bend. It affects the current density and result in uneven plating thickness and may cause short circuit.

Platinized titanium anode is a good option in hard chrome plating. It reduces the amount of hazardous lead sludge generation, is dimensional stability, resulting in a more stable, homogeneous, and consistent-thickness plating process. Platinized anodes are much more flexible in shaping and dimensioning and can be designed according to the shapes of the work pieces to be plated.

Tiaano employs titanium tube as substrate, since it produces uniform current density and excellent plating results. It also enables gases to escape more effectively and increase the movement of the electrolyte. Also give a higher coating current density and smaller distances between the anode and the cathode.

The Niobium is the anode electrode made of Niobium which is having the coating or Plating of platinum. Platinum is used on the surface as a primary anode material due to its excellent corrosion resistance under anodic conditions coupled with its ability to pass current in all electrolytes. The corrosion resistance of platinum manifests itself in its low consumption rate. Its major disadvantage is its high cost, thus making it clear that it is most desirable to use as little platinum as is necessary. In order to restrict the amount of platinum used and to maintain an anode of some structural integrity, it is necessary to use some type of substrate material.

Both titanium and niobium have the ability to withstand anodic conditions, and both possess unique advantages and disadvantages as a substrate for platinum.

The major advantage of titanium is its low cost, particularly when considering its lower density. A disadvantage of titanium is its poor conductivity; approximately 5 times less than niobium and 50 times less than copper. Low conductivity makes titanium poorly suited for long wire lengths and restricts its use to larger diameter, shorter anodes.

The use of niobium as a substrate to platinum eliminates many of the problems with titanium. Although its conductivity is higher than that of titanium, it is often still too low for use in small diameters and long lengths. The principal advantage of niobium is its relatively high voltage potential.

Material Considerations in Platinum Anode Design:-

Niobium (Nb): High cost, high breakdown potential, fair conductivity.

Titanium (Ti): Low cost, low breakdown potential, poor conductivity.

Platinum (Pt): High corrosion resistance, high cost, good conductivity.

Tiaano manufacturing different dimensions and Shapes of platinum or platinised electrode for water ionizers. Water ionizers are marketed for commercial and home use.  These devices use a process called electrolysis to produce electrolyzed waters called functional waters.

Alkaline ionized water and acidic water are generated around the cathode and anode, respectively by water electrolysis in the electrolysis cell. The key factor for a quality water ionizer is the material of the electrodes (Pt Anodes and Pt Cathodes). Most good Water Ionizers on the market use electrodes made of platinum plated with grade 1 titanium. Titanium will not dissolve in your ionized water.

Water Ionization: The Platinised Titanium electrodes create the ionization, the electrode cell is the heart of an ionizer. It consists of a series of electrodes (plates), each separated by a membrane. The Platinized Titanium Mesh Anode is mostly used, because it has outstanding practical performance, such as strong ability of ionization release, good exchange of electrolyte, close structure and light weight, etc.
